LATEST TREND

Sustainable LAB Production Using Renewable Feedstock and Advanced Catalysis is a Trend


One of the more prevalent trends emerging in the LAB market is the utilization of green chemistry for production process. Companies are starting to replace traditional hydrogen fluoride-based catalysts with solid acid and zeolite catalysts to lower environmental impact. There is also a growing interest in renewable kerosene alternatives such as plant-based paraffin, in order to make sustainable LAB as well. All of this is taking place alongside international sustainability initiatives mostly in Europe and North America. LINEAR ALKYL BENZENE MARKET SEGMENTATION

BY TYPE


• Heavy Linear Alkyl Benzene (HLAB): Primarily used in industrial applications and heavy-duty cleaners, HLAB has higher molecular weights and delivers extended cleaning power. It is widely used in institutional cleaning and oilfield chemicals.


• Light Linear Alkyl Benzene (LLAB): Dominantly used in household detergents and personal care products, LLAB is known for its excellent biodegradability and foaming properties. It holds a major share due to its versatility in formulations.

BY APPLICATION


• Detergents: The largest application segment, linear alkyl benzene (LAB) is a precursor for labelling alkyl sulfate (LAS), the main surfactant in laundry detergents and dishwashing detergents. Increased urbanization in developing economies is driving demand as base-level hygiene continues to gain prominence.

• Cleaners: LAB as a surfactant is found in products for both domestic and institutional cleaning agents. Surfactants based on LAB are very cost-competitive and also meet environmental/hygiene standards in product formulations.

• Industrial Uses: LAB also finds its way into lubricants, paints, agrochemicals and as a solvent in industrial processes. This segment will also see modest growth due to potential manufacturing recoveries in part linked to urban infrastructure projects.

RESTRAINING FACTOR

Raw Material Price Volatility and Supply Chain Disruptions Hinders Growth


LAB production relies on petrochemical feedstocks (benzene and kerosene) which change with the crude oil prices; the unpredictability of crude oil prices distorts production costs and margins, which hampers investment. Additionally, raw material shortages caused by geopolitical issues and logistical breakdowns put supply chains at risk. Companies are exploring feeding stock diversification and vertical integration methods to address some of these concerns.

Growing Competition from Bio-Based Surfactants and Alternative Chemistries is a Challenge

Challenge

The growing usage of bio-surfactants like alkyl polyglycolides (APGs) and methyl ester sulfonates (MES) is a competitive threat to products that use LAB because these alternatives are considered sustainable, they are gaining traction with premium personal care and cleaning brands. In order to counter the threat of bio-surfactants and adapt to emerging sustainable markets, LAB will require investment in further developing its green chemistry and focus on branding LAB and reshaping buyer perceptions in sustainable markets.

KEY INDUSTRY PLAYERS

Key Industry Players Shaping the Market Through Innovation and Expansion


Some of the leading companies in the LAB market are CEPSA Química (Spain), Sasol (South Africa), Farabi Petrochemicals (Saudi Arabia), ISU Chemical (South Korea) and Reliance Industries (India). These firms are leaders in the volume/capacity of LAB produced as well as in technology development and sustainability initiatives. CEPSA has established green LAB production in Europe, while Farabi and ISU have developed a dominant position in Asian markets. Reliance focuses on its competitive advantage through its integration with petrochemical operations in the country for cost leadership.
